Neurotech Pharmaceuticals, Inc. is a private biotech company located in Cumberland, RI and Needham, MA, within the realm of Greater Boston’s vast biotechnology landscape. Since our inception more than 20 years ago, our focus has been on developing and commercializing transformative therapies for chronic eye diseases. The core platform technology, Encapsulated Cell Therapy (ECT), is a first-in-class drug delivery platform designed to slow the progression of chronic eye diseases. Neurotech’s first commercial product, ENCELTO TM (revakinagene taroretcel-lwey), is approved in the United States for the treatment of adults with idiopathic Macular Telangiectasia Type 2 (MacTel). Encapsulated cell-based gene therapy is designed to provide long-term, sustained delivery of therapeutic proteins for the treatment of chronic eye diseases.
Reporting to the Vice President of Market Access, the Senior Director, Access Strategy and Operations will be a key leader within the Market Access team, responsible for leading access strategy, access marketing initiatives and operational execution for Neurotech’s ENCELTO resulting in appropriate patient access.
The role requires a strategic mindset, a collaborative approach, and a strong commitment to building a culture of ownership, accountability, and trust. This individual will be responsible for developing and executing innovative marketing strategies and tactics to engage and facilitate timely and appropriate patient access. Responsibilities will also include managing Market Access operations, which include, HUB process performance, analytics, cross function training and budget process. The role requires deep expertise in U.S. market access dynamics, rare/orphan disease challenges, and cross-functional leadership to translate clinical value into sustainable access strategies.
This position is Remote however, it has the option to be located in Neurotech’s commercial offices in Needham, Massachusetts.
Responsibilities
Market Access Strategy & Execution
Scope, develop and execute promotional payer marketing initiatives to reinforce value proposition to managed care customers: Commercial, Medicare, Medicaid, VA/DOD and IDNs. Develop and execute field reimbursement pull through collateral to educate academic centers, ASC’s, health systems, HCPs and office staff on access and reimbursement process for ENCELTO Collaborate with field reimbursement, sales and marketing to focus on setting access expectations, ways of working and communicating to ensure optimal patient and customer experience. Highly effective cross-functional collaboration is essential to ensure commercial alignment to key strategies and tactics Continuously assess payer policies, coverage trends, and utilization management impacts to support post-approval commercialization. Coordinate strategy and promotional tactics for major industry meetings and conventions. Market Access Operations & Analytics
Manage Market Access operations, including data analytics, budget planning processes, and performance metrics. Coordinate and analyze coverage policies, PSP data, and stakeholder feedback to drive continuous improvement. Lead internal Market Access training initiatives to elevate organizational access literacy and build cross-functional trust. Stakeholder Engagement & Cross-Functional Leadership
Serve as the internal subject matter expert on access-related risks and opportunities, aligning access strategy with brand positioning and patient journeys. Collaborate closely with Field Market Access, Field Sales, Brand Marketing, Regulatory, Medical Affairs, and Patient Services teams.
Education & Experience
Bachelor’s degree required; advanced degree strongly preferred. 10+ years of progressive commercial experience within the biopharmaceutical industry, with a focus on specialty, rare, or orphan diseases. 5+ years of dedicated Market Access leadership experience. Proven track record of ensuring market access operational effectiveness including patient services process improvement, CRM implementation, access KPI reporting and cross-functional collaboration with key commercial partners Demonstrated experience in retina or ophthalmology therapeutic areas is highly preferred. Proven track record of supporting successful product launches and post-approval commercialization. Essential experience working with HUB services, reimbursement systems, and specialty pharmacy models. Willingness to travel as needed to support team and business objectives.
